Landslide closes road south of Darby

UPDATE 6:18 p.m. — One traffic lane is now open on West Fork Road near mile marker 13, according to the Ravalli County Sheriff.

Motorists are being advised to drive extremely slow and carefully in the area.


DARBY – West Fork Road south of Darby is closed around mile marker 13 due to a landslide.

The Ravalli County Sheriff is reporting power is out in the area and both the power company and the road department are working to clear the highway.

One lane should be open around 8 p.m. Tuesday night.
